The product should not automatically be described as structural building lumber unless it carries an appropriate structural grade stamp. Western Red Cedar is often sold in appearance and specialty grades rather than structural grades. Canada Wood Group
For load-bearing benches, the required spans, support spacing, fastener locations and attachment method depend on the bench dimensions and installation design. Customers should follow an appropriate sauna plan or project-specific construction details.
Why Use Western Red Cedar in a Sauna?
Western Red Cedar, botanically known as Thuja plicata, is valued for its low density, dimensional stability, natural durability, workability and distinctive aroma. Its relatively low shrinkage helps it resist excessive warping, twisting and checking as surrounding humidity changes. Real Cedar
The wood’s low density also contributes to its natural insulating characteristics. This is particularly useful in a sauna, where customers generally prefer wood components that transfer heat more slowly than dense materials or exposed metal. Real Cedar
Western Red Cedar is also easy to cut, shape, plane and sand. Its workability makes it suitable for both professional sauna builders and experienced DIY customers creating custom benches, backrests and interior details. Canada Wood describes the species as lightweight, moderately soft and well suited to machining and smooth finishing. Canada Wood Group
Natural Knotty Cedar Character
Knotty cedar creates a warmer and more rustic appearance than clear Western Red Cedar. Instead of a nearly uniform face, each board includes its own combination of knots, grain patterns and natural colour transitions.
Western Red Cedar can range from light straw and amber tones to pinkish red, reddish brown and deeper brown shades. When multiple boards are used together, this variation produces a distinctive natural bench or support assembly rather than a uniform manufactured appearance.
